Quality of Patient Care

Official quality performance data from CMS. Higher percentages indicate better performance unless noted otherwise.

Timely Initiation of Care97.2%
Flu Vaccination Rate76.3%
Improvement in Walking/Mobility86.2%
Improvement in Bathing87.6%
Improvement in Managing Medications82.8%
Improvement in Breathing88.7%
Falls with Major Injury0.8%

Lower is better

Note: Quality measures are based on actual patient care data reported to CMS and reflect the agency's performance over the past reporting period.
